Arcturus Therapeutics convened key players from translational biology, clinical development, and the patient community for Rare Disease Day.
The event aimed to create new momentum in collaboration and foster meaningful progress in the fight against rare diseases. Company representatives reaffirmed their commitment to listening to patient needs, symbolized by the well-known zebra motif in rare disease advocacy. The gathering underscored the growing importance of patient voices in shaping research and development strategies for the rare disease sector.
